Hacienda searches for new home following COVID-19's impact

Editor's note: This clip is from May 5, 2020
ROCK HILL, Mo. - Rock Hills's beloved Hacienda announced on Monday that it will be relocating following COVID-19's impact on the restaurant.
"We've absolutely loved being part of this community and sharing so many memories with you over the years," the business wrote on social media.
According to the business, maintaining the 150-year-old building was a privilege, but it also had its challenges. Citing growing economic hardships that transpired in the aftermath of the pandemic, Hacienda placed a for-sale sign outside the establishment.
Despite this news, Hacienda is in the process of searching for a new home so that it can continue its mission in serving the community. In reassurance to patrons, the restaurant states that it remains open for the foreseeable future.
"We hope you'll continue to make memories with us," the business concluded.
